
The service offers advice and guidance to individuals overseeing their own care package, whether through direct payments or self-funding. It provides assistance in identifying appropriate care options, such as engaging with agencies or hiring a personal assistant, as well as aiding in the establishment and upkeep of care packages while planning for emergencies. The organisation conducts several drop-in sessions via Skype for those seeking information on Direct Payments and hosts Peer Support groups.
Provides support to:
- People with an autistic spectrum condition
- Carers
- People with dementia
- People with SEN/learning disabilities
- People with mental health difficulties
- Older people
- People with physical disabilities
- People with sensory impairment
- People with an acquired brain injury
- People with challenging behaviour
